Pros & cons summary
| Performance score | 0.29 | 0.89 |
| Recency | 8 January 2011 | 5 January 2015 |
| Chip lithography | 40 nm | 14 nm |
HD Graphics (Broadwell) has a 206.9% higher aggregate performance score, an age advantage of 3 years, and a 185.7% more advanced lithography process.
The HD Graphics (Broadwell) is our recommended choice as it beats the NVS 300 in performance tests.
Be aware that NVS 300 is a workstation graphics card while HD Graphics (Broadwell) is a notebook one.
